High-Density Mezzanine Receptacle for Tight Stack Heights
The Hirose FX10A-80S/8-SV(91) is an 80-position receptacle from the FunctionMax™ FX10 series, designed for parallel board-to-board stacking. The 0.020" (0.50mm) pitch and 2-row layout pack 80 circuits into a compact footprint, with a height above board of 0.126" (3.20mm). It supports mated stacking heights of 4mm and 5mm, making it suitable for space-constrained mezzanine applications where board spacing is tight. The receptacle uses center strip contacts with gold plating (4.00µin thickness) on the mating interface, ensuring reliable signal integrity over repeated mating cycles.
The mated stacking heights of 4mm and 5mm are set by the choice of mating plug — the FX10 series includes matching headers with different post heights. For a 4mm stack, use the corresponding FX10 plug with the shorter post; for 5mm, the taller post version. Verify the plug's height code against your board-to-board z-height budget before committing the BOM. The 0.50mm pitch demands careful PCB routing — trace widths and spacing must accommodate the fine-pitch escape. The ground plate provides a low-inductance return path, which helps control crosstalk in high-speed digital links. The board guide assists optical alignment during hand-assembly or pick-and-place.
